Scientific Data Images for EML4 Antibody
Western Blot: EML4 Antibody [NBP1-05973]
Western Blot: EML4 Antibody [NBP1-05973] - Detection of Human EML4 by Western Blot. Samples: Whole cell lysate (50, 15 ug) from HeLa cells prepared using NETN lysis buffer. Antibody: Affinity purified rabbit anti-EML4 antibody NBP1-05973 used for WB at 0.04 ug/ml. Detection: Chemiluminescence with an exposure time of 30 seconds.Immunohistochemistry-Paraffin: EML4 Antibody [NBP1-05973]
Immunohistochemistry-Paraffin: EML4 Antibody [NBP1-05973] - FFPE section of human ovarian carcinoma. Antibody: Affinity purified rabbit anti-EML4 used at a dilution of1:1000 (0.2ug/ml). Detection: DABImmunoprecipitation: EML4 Antibody [NBP1-05973]
Immunoprecipitation: EML4 Antibody [NBP1-05973] - Detection of human EML4 by western blot of immunoprecipitates. Samples: Whole cell lysate (0.5 or 1.0 mg per IP reaction; 20% of IP loaded) from HeLa cells prepared using NETN lysis buffer. Antibodies: Affinity purified rabbit anti-EML4 antibody NBP1-05973 (lot NBP1-05973-2) used for IP at 6 ug per reaction. EML4 was also immunoprecipitated by a previous lot of this antibody (lot NBP1-05973-1) and rabbit anti-EML4 antibody NBP1-05974. For blotting immunoprecipitated EML4, NBP1-05973 was used at 0.1 ug/ml. Detection: Chemiluminescence with an exposure time of 10 seconds.Applications for EML4 Antibody
